I think the word "hero" is over used these days, but not in John McCain's case. He exemplified the word hero. When he was captive, and when he was on the senate floor he always did what he felt was the right thing to do, that takes courage. On a more personal note, my dear friend spent an afternoon with him, her words to me yesterday, "I spent a whole day with dear John McCain. He had his driver drop him off at the ranch gate and he walked the two miles in, LOL! He knew my dad and he berated me for being too tan (he still had band aids on from his skin cancer surgery). He was totally genuine and sincerely sweet."
